Understanding the Concept of Information Portals

An information portal serves as a centralized online platform that aggregates digital resources, offering users seamless access to curated content. These portals act as gateways to knowledge, integrating diverse data sources to simplify complex information. Unlike traditional websites, they prioritize organization, ensuring users can navigate through vast amounts of data efficiently. By combining functionality with accessibility, information portals have become essential tools in both personal and professional contexts.

The Importance of Data Accuracy in Information Portals

A reliable data source is the cornerstone of any successful information portal. Inaccurate or outdated information can lead to poor decision-making, especially in fields like finance, healthcare, or academia. To maintain credibility, portals employ rigorous verification processes, cross-checking data from trusted institutions. Regular audits and user feedback mechanisms help identify errors promptly. This commitment to accuracy ensures that users depend on the portal as a primary reference point.

Security Measures for Protecting Sensitive Data

Given the volume of sensitive data stored in information portals, robust security protocols are non-negotiable. Encryption techniques, multi-factor authentication, and role-based access controls prevent unauthorized breaches. Regular vulnerability assessments and compliance with regulations like GDPR or HIPAA further safeguard user privacy. These measures ensure that even when handling confidential information, portals remain secure and trustworthy.

Best Practices for Designing Accessible Portals

Accessibility is paramount in information portal design. Adhering to Web Content Accessibility Guidelines (WCAG) ensures compatibility with screen readers and assistive technologies. Clear typography, high contrast colors, and keyboard navigation support users with disabilities. A user-friendly interface also reduces learning curves, making the portal usable for individuals of all technical backgrounds.

The Impact of AI on Information Portal Development

AI is revolutionizing information portals by enabling predictive analytics and automated content tagging. Machine learning models identify patterns in user queries, pre-emptively suggesting relevant resources. Chatbots powered by natural language processing resolve common issues instantly, freeing human staff for more complex tasks. These advancements make portals not just repositories of information but proactive advisors.
